Output 5b660fa7e804613eddaee526ebb077d2aaee8f29b5dbfd40ee53e5c9faa753ea:4

value
86347
script pubkey
OP_0 OP_PUSHBYTES_20 ed1ec8f1da47a0703fff3abc84710073bf34f643
address
bc1qa50v3uw6g7s8q0ll827ggugqwwlnfajrecvt3d
transaction
5b660fa7e804613eddaee526ebb077d2aaee8f29b5dbfd40ee53e5c9faa753ea
confirmations
54424
spent
true